First Lady Jacqueline Kennedys (JBK) Musical Program for Youth. The Paul Winter Sextet plays onstage in the East Room of the White House, Washington, D.C.; members of the band are (L-R): Warren Bernhardt (piano), Les Rout (baritone saxophone), Richard Evans (bass), Paul Winter (alto saxophone), Harold Jones (drums), and Dick Whitsell (trumpet). The jazz group performed as part of the fifth installment of First Lady Jacqueline Kennedys Musical Programs for Youth by Youth; Mrs. Kennedy held the event for the children of ambassadors, members of Cabinet, and State Department officials living in Washington, D.C.

'Sugar Chile' Robinson at the Piano --The vacuum left by the-departure of boxer Sugar Ray Robinson and his colourful circus of assistants and Supporters will be filled next Saturday. On that day a new entertainment Organisation flies into London,Heading it is Frank Issac Robinson, 11-year old boogie-woogie thumping phenomenon of the piano. His trade name is 'Sugar Chile', his entourage consists of a tutor, an attorney, a personal manager, and his father who is taking I holiday from his coal and ice business in Detroit's 'Little Harlem'. The ebony-hued youngster has built big reputation for himself in America. July 23, 1951. (Photo by Reuterphoto).
